Is Colchester CO14 8 a good place to live?

In Colchester (CO14 8), recorded crime is about the national average, homes sell for around £265,162 on average, there are 2 schools in the area (2 of 2 Ofsted-rated Good or Outstanding), flood risk from rivers and the sea is high, and it ranks as a more deprived area than most (deprivation decile 2/10, where 1 is most deprived).

Flood risk in Colchester CO14 8

Flood risk from rivers and the sea in Colchester CO14 8 is rated high. Around 18.5% of properties (876 of 4,725) sit in a modelled flood zone, of which 287 are at significant risk.

Source: Environment Agency, Risk of Flooding from Rivers and Sea, updated 2026-06-27. Surface-water and groundwater flooding are modelled separately and are not included here. Commission an official flood search before purchase.
